Here’s an interesting CNN article on British data suggesting that the mass-extinction event that humans started about 50,000 years ago (which wiped out lots of large mammals, for instance) is continuing. Unsurprising, but it's neat to see actual data about current effects. Thanks to my mother for forwarding the link.
